Boundary Dimensions of SCA Stadium

Saurashtra Cricket Association: Unlike older grounds that were often irregular in shape, the Saurashtra Cricket Association Stadium was designed with modern standards in mind. It has a symmetrical, oval layout, and although the exact distances may vary slightly based on pitch placement (central or off-center), the average boundary measurements are relatively consistent.

DirectionApproximate Distance (meters)
Straight Boundaries65 – 68 meters
Square Boundaries63 – 66 meters
Long On / Long Off64 – 67 meters
Fine Leg / Third Man58 – 62 meters

Saurashtra Cricket Association: These measurements classify the ground as medium-sized by international standards, with relatively short square and fine-leg boundaries, making it a haven for aggressive batsmen.

Match Impact: Batting, Bowling, and Fielding

1. Batting Advantage

Shorter square and fine-leg boundaries at the SCA Stadium favor batsmen, particularly in the T20 and ODI formats. With a central pitch placement:

  • Batsmen can target gaps and clear ropes with less power.
  • A well-timed flick or cut shot often races to the boundary.
  • Six-hitting becomes a strategic focus, especially during the final overs.

Key Stats:

  • Average 1st innings score in T20Is: ~180+
  • IPL matches here often see totals exceeding 200

2. Bowler’s Adaptation

Saurashtra Cricket Association: Short boundaries don’t mean bowlers are helpless — but they must adapt:

  • Spinners often focus on flatter trajectories and bowling into the pitch to prevent elevation.
  • Pace bowlers benefit from wide yorkers, cutters, and slower balls to restrict power hitting.
  • Line and length become critical — straying onto pads or too wide often results in boundaries.
Bowling StrategyWhy It Works in Rajkot
Wide YorkersMinimize hitting angles on short square
Short Slower BallsDifficult to time; adds deception
Back-of-a-length SpinReduces lofted shots, forces mistiming

3. Fielding Tactics

The boundary layout also influences fielding placements:

  • Deep square leg and deep cover are almost always guarded.
  • Faster fielders are placed on the square boundary due to frequent flat shots.
  • Boundary riders are often given a few extra meters to anticipate big hits.

Pitch Placement and Boundary Variation

Cricket stadiums often shift the pitch slightly across the square to manage wear and tear. At SCA Stadium, this movement can affect boundary size.

Pitch PositionEffect on Boundary
Central PitchBalanced on all sides
Towards Pavilion EndAirport End boundaries become longer
Towards Airport EndPavilion End becomes shorter

Teams batting second sometimes gain a strategic advantage by assessing these variations and setting field or bowling plans accordingly.
